**Recovery: ScanBridge account lockout**

If the ScanBridge service account gets locked after a failed barcode-scanner pairing, don't panic — this happens most release weeks. Re-enable the account in the Fennelworth admin console, then re-run the pairing job so the Zettle-9 scanners reconnect. Heads up: the reset wizard will ask for the recovery passphrase before it issues new pairing tokens, so have it ready.

vault phrase of kawif-hahif = olidor-raldor-praion

### v2.7.1 — Bounceflow Processor

This release corrects a defect where soft bounces from the Mailharbor relay were misclassified as permanent failures, causing premature suppression of valid recipients. Classification now consults the full SMTP status code rather than the first digit only. A backfill job restores incorrectly suppressed addresses from the last 30 days. Please hold the release train until backfill verification completes, coordinated by the engineer named below.

account owner for bawip-tahag: Raleth Quenok

It rotates database credentials, API tokens, and signing keys on a fixed schedule defined in the rotation manifest. As a contractor, you will receive read-only access by default; write access requires sponsor approval from the Platform Custody team. Before your first rotation run, complete the sandbox walkthrough and confirm your audit logging is enabled. Rotation failures page the custody rotation channel automatically. For access requests, manifest questions, or anything unclear in this document, reach out to the team.

escalation mailbox, bafog-fafog: ulador@paliqlabs.internal